Susan Zweig, MD, is a Clinical Professor at NYU Grossman School of Medicine and the Medical Director at Diabetes Endocrine Associates. Her expertise encompasses endocrinology, particularly in treating patients with glandular disorders, diabetes, thyroid issues, menstrual fertility challenges, and osteoporosis. She is a dedicated educator who trains medical students and residents, while also actively participating in clinical trials aimed at innovating treatment modalities for endocrine disorders. Dr. Zweig has been featured in prominent listings such as New York Magazine’s 'Best Doctors' and U.S. News Top Doctor series, reflecting her recognition in the field. As a member of several professional organizations, including the American Diabetes Association and the Endocrine Society, she remains at the forefront of clinical practice, focusing on enhancing patient outcomes through comprehensive and personalized care.
